Project Engineer I/II (Electrical / Pipeline) - Canonsburg, PA
DT Midstream is an energy industry leader with over 20 years of proven success in midstream pipeline, storage, and gathering assets. The Project Engineer I/II role involves applying engineering principles to manage projects and field engineering assignments, including analysis, design, and system performance monitoring.

Responsibilities
Applies knowledge and background of engineering principles to the midstream industry
Develops, coordinates, and directs critical projects or field engineering assignments
Provide analysis, design, specification and cost estimates for jurisdictional and non-jurisdictional natural gas gathering and transmission systems
Develop scope of work, manage bid process and pipeline and facility design/construction
Review and assess new technology, processes, materials and equipment
Frame engineering/operational problems and propose solutions
Monitor and support engineering related activities as related to field construction projects
Monitor system performance and prepare long and short-term facility plans including costs
Must be able to make sound engineering decisions under limited time constraints
Initiates or performs engineering studies, proposing solutions or recommending alternatives
Prepare written procedures to facilitate construction, maintenance, pipeline integrity assessments and operation of gas transmission and gathering systems
Provide technical support to field as needed
Prepare and present technical reports on projects
Contribute to the development of the budget and containment of project costs
Conduct studies and analyses to assist in the resolution of engineering-related issues; may assist with developing engineering standards and practices
Qualification
Required
A Bachelor's degree in Engineering and 0 - 1 year of job-related experience is required
Level II - 3 years of job-related experience is required
Must possess and maintain a valid driver's license and meet company-driving standards
Knowledge of design, installation and commissioning of gas pipeline system including gathering and transmission pipelines, gas/liquid separation, heating and flow/pressure regulation, measurement and odorization
Knowledge of planning and execution of pipeline integrity management tasks including ILI and DA, pipeline remediation, threat identification, risk assessment and records management
Knowledge of industry codes and standards including applicable Federal, State, and local regulations, laws, and codes, ASME Piping Codes, National Electric Code, CFR 192, DOT, and PHMSA rules and regulations
Solid analytical, planning, organization, time management and problem-solving skills
Assist with leading cross functional teams
Ability to interpret blueprints/drawings/schematics and other design documents
Communicate effectively both orally and in writing with people at all levels both within and outside the company
Effective in self-management of time with a demonstrated personal commitment to work
